Byron Buxton experienced a setback with his right hip impingement, prompting concerns for his All-Star Game participation. He was removed from a game against the Yankees after an attempted steal. Meanwhile, Connelly Early has been placed on the 15-day injured list due to left elbow inflammation after departing early from a start against the Nationals. Mike Trout is expected to return to the lineup after recovering from a hamstring strain. Updates on their statuses are anticipated soon as the All-Star break nears.
